About 1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ine
1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ine (PubChem CID 79618401) has the molecular formula C17H32N2
and a molecular weight of 264.46 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ine.

What is the SMILES notation for 1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ine?
The canonical SMILES for 1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ine is CCNC1CCCC(N(C)CC2CC3CCC2C3)C1.
What is the InChIKey of 1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ine?
The InChIKey is SWUPVSHOFPBUST-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C17H32N2/c1-3-18-16-5-4-6-17(11-16)19(2)12-15-10-13-7-8-14(15)9-13/h13-18H,3-12H2,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of 1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ine?
1-N-(2-bicyclo[2.2.1]heptanylmethyl)-3-N-ethyl-1-N-methylcyclohexane-1,3-diamine has a molecular weight of 264.46 g/mol, XLogP of 3.28, 5 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 2 hydrogen bond acceptors.
